Well, we've been telling you Julio Lugo's errors tend to come on routine plays, and he just threw away what would have been an inning ending grounder by Joe Mauer. The throw sailed to the home plate side of first.
And, naturally, it cost the Sox. Pineiro was unable to pick up his shortstop, as Rondell White lined a single. 1-0, Twins.
First unearned run of the season.
